The Authoritative DNS server is a fundamental component of the DNS (Domain Name System) infrastructure. Its main responsibility is to store all of the essential information for a particular domain name and also to answer DNS queries related to that domain. They give DNS data to the Recursive DNS servers. Read additional information about the Authoritative DNS server!

The PTR record, also known as the Pointer record, links an IP address to the corresponding domain name. It is exactly the opposite of the A record, which points the domain name to its IP address. It is used in Reverse DNS lookups, a query that starts with the IP address and looks up the domain name. Find more details about the PTR record!

DNSSEC stands for Domain Name System Security Extensions, which is a beneficial technique that boosts the security of your domain name. It is a perfect addition to your DNS that is going to attach to every DNS record a digital signature. This feature gives you the ability to guarantee the source of your domain name is genuine.
